Makurdi has an average annual daytime high of 32.9°C, based on the 1951 to 1980 baseline. Its warmest month is March, when highs typically reach 36.7°C, and its coldest is December, with overnight lows near 20.5°C.

Month by month averages

MonthAvg highAvg low
January34.7°C20.8°C
February36.4°C22.7°C
March36.7°C24.6°CWarmest
April35.3°C24.6°C
May33.3°C23.7°C
June31.0°C22.7°C
July29.3°C22.2°C
August29.1°C22.3°C
September29.9°C22.5°C
October31.1°C22.4°C
November33.3°C21.5°C
December34.3°C20.5°CColdest

Is Makurdi getting hotter?

Since 1900, Makurdi's average temperature has risen by +1.6°C. Compared to the earliest station records that begin in 1885, warming totals +1.6°C.
